scruffyduck Posted March 10, 2017 Share Posted March 10, 2017 You first issue in creating scenery for FSX:SE is the SDK. This is a developers kit that contains the different tools needed to create scenery and in particular some compilers. If you do have FSX somewhere then you may have the SDK. Otherwise there is on provided free by Lockheed Martin for Prepar3D v1.4. This is the same as the FSX one and can be downloaded from the Prepar3D web site. Making your own buildings involves a 3D design tool such as Sketchup. Of you plans above which comes first? scruffyduck Posted March 11, 2017 Share Posted March 11, 2017 I think you can install the FSX SDK without FSX. It is a long time since I did it but I seem to recall that the SDK installer is separate from the FSX installer. If you install and update to the SDK then that does check to see if an acceptable version of the SDK is already installed but I don't think it checks whether FSX is. At the very worst I suspect you could install the lot and then removed FSX. However the option of using the P3D v1.4 SDK is still there and that does not check for the presence of the sim itself.
